What Is Mebibit Per Second (Mibps)? Definition and Uses

A mebibit per second is 1,024 kibibits per second. Binary equivalent of Mbps.

The mebibit per second is a binary bit-based unit measuring data transfer speed, network bandwidth, or throughput capacity. Like the units used to measure file size, it's one of several data measurement units that scale using either decimal multiples of 1,000 (SI) or binary steps of 1,024 (IEC).

Don't confuse Mibps with MiB/s (Mebibyte Per Second) — capitalization matters here. Mibps measures bits, MiB/s measures bytes, and since 1 byte = 8 bits, 1 Mibps works out to just 0.125 MiB/s using the same numeral.
